The subject of this article is part of an MCU franchise story that has been officially deemed to be non-canonical to the primary continuity of the Marvel Cinematic Universe. Its events instead occur in another reality within the Multiverse. This universe is designated as "Ultimo Transformation".

Strategic Homeland Intervention, Enforcement and Logistics Division, abbreviated as S.H.I.E.L.D. is a spy agency.

History[]

Spy Activities[]

S.H.I.E.L.D. was founded as a spy organization and involved itself in an insurrection being led by Valentin Shatalov in Russia. They sent Natasha Romanoff to the facility in order to determine what Shatalov was doing, and she sent back pictures of a Crimson Dynamo Armor.[1]

Attack on the Tesla Facility[]

S.H.I.E.L.D. responded to separatists taking over an energy facility in Russia using new technology when Tony Stark called Nick Fury requesting permission to land in the country and investigate the same facility. Not believing it to be a coincidence, Fury cleared the group to investigate. Stark went with a group of S.H.I.E.L.D. agents in helicopters toward the base while the Fury led an attack from the other side using the Helicarrier. Stark escorted the soldiers and defended them from attacks, but they were attacked by a Roxxon Armiger which killed a pilot. Stark destroyed the Armiger and guided them to the facility, where they joined the assault on Valentin Shatalov's insurrectionists. They defeated the insurrectionists, but ultimately realized that Shatalov was not there.[1]

Tracking Valentin Shatalov[]

Tony Stark hacked into S.H.I.E.L.D. and got information on Shatalov, and Nick Fury ultimately decided to allow Stark to do so. Fury revealed that Natasha Romanoff had not reported in several days, so Stark went to the power plant where Romanoff was and decided to destroy the plant and rescue Romanoff. Stark found Romanoff and helped her reach a S.H.I.E.L.D. extraction. Stark defeated Valentin Shatalov and met with Romanoff, who explained what she had learned, including that Kearson DeWitt was behind the Theft of the Dataspine.

Stark, Romanoff, and James Rhodes went to a facility where Project P.R.O.T.E.A.N. was being run, and S.H.I.E.L.D. accompanied them. They waited nearby as Stark's armor got infected by P.R.O.T.E.A.N. technology. Stark asked Fury to fire on the base at Stark's word, and Fury hesitantly agreed. Once the facility was destroyed, a S.H.I.E.L.D. Sweep Team was sent to search for DeWitt, but could not find any sign of him. Fury watched as Ultimo infected J.A.R.V.I.S. and threatened to kill everyone Stark cared about, ordering medical teams for Rhodes and Stark.[1]

Operation Daybreak[]

A.I.M. carried out an attack on the Helicarrier, causing Nick Fury to mobilize his troops. Tony Stark, forced to use a weaker version of the Iron Man armor, defended the Helicarrier as long as he could until James Rhodes was able to get out of bed rest and take the Stark Industries Private Jet away from the fight, allowing both himself and Stark to recover. Rhodes then took over the fight and defeated the attackers, including a large A.I.M. Arc Armiger. Stark and Rhodes retaliated by figuring out Ultimo's next move and destroying Project Greengrid.[1]

Battle at Stark Archives[]

Tony Stark and James Rhodes set a trap for Ultimo at Stark Archives which S.H.I.E.L.D. participated in. Stark attempted to reason with Ultimo, but when this failed, ordered S.H.I.E.L.D. to launch a series of missiles at Ultimo from the Helicarrier. This allowed Stark to enter Ultimo's body and learn about him. Meanwhile, Rhodes fought Ultimo with air support from S.H.I.E.L.D. Fury tried to help using recovered Project Greengrid technology, but Ultimo hijacked the technology and used it to infect Rhodes' armor. S.H.I.E.L.D. sent several helicopters toward the fight as Stark asked for S.H.I.E.L.D. and Rhodes to collectively hit Ultimo and cause a lot of damage all at once, which they did. One of the S.H.I.E.L.D. helicopters started to fall, so Rhodes helped keep it up. Once Stark was safely out of Ultrimo's body, Fury crashed the Helicarrier into it, destroying Ultimo once and for all.[1]
